## Environments: Lanternfish Search

Quick note for reviewers poking at our nightly reindex. Every night around 02:10 the Lanternfish reindexer rebuilds the catalog index in staging first, then prod, using a read-only replica so it can't mangle live data. Access is scoped to the indexer role only — nothing else should touch those tables. The settings the job runs with are shown below.

config for kawif-hahig:
zorix:
  log_level: error
  metrics_host: metrics.zorix.lumiclabs.internal
  pool_size: 16

Welcome to Halbrook Tower, contractors!

Lift maintenance happens on weekends only, usually Saturdays from 7am. Sign in at the loading dock — the desk there is staffed until noon. Park in the rear bay, not the visitor spots. The motor room is on level 12; take the service stair, as the passenger lifts will obviously be off. The keypad by the service stair door takes the contractor code below.

staff pass of kagup-fajog = bdg-QCHVQW-99665837

**TICKET NF-2291: Vault locked — fan-out backpressure config unreachable**

Priority: High. Assigned: Release management.

The Corvette notifier is dropping events under load; backpressure thresholds need raising before the Thursday cut. Problem: the config vault for the fan-out service auto-locked after three failed unseal attempts during last night's rotation. Queue depth is climbing on the Harlow cluster. Rollback is not viable — the old limits are worse. To unseal and patch the thresholds, enter the recovery passphrase below:

unlock words, kadug-tahog: casax-holath

Q3 Finance Review — Draymont Logistics. Effective immediately, hiring in the Western Freight division is frozen. Open requisitions are cancelled; backfills require CFO sign-off. Payroll run-rate exceeded plan by 6%, driven by overtime in the Kelver depot. Branch managers must submit revised staffing forecasts by Friday. No exceptions for seasonal hires this cycle. The note below outlines the rationale and must not be shared beyond this list.

confidential, kagep-kahof: Druokax Systems plans to lower the Ulaath list price by 53 percent in March.